Recientemente, Flipkart vino a mi universidad para los pasantes de SDE. GeeksForGeeks me ayudó mucho a prepararme para las pruebas de codificación y para las entrevistas.
1ra Ronda. – En línea – 60 minutos
La primera ronda fue una ronda en línea alojada en hackerrank.com. Hubo 3 preguntas de codificación, cada una de ellas con un nivel superior al promedio.
13 estudiantes fueron preseleccionados después de esta ronda para entrevistas técnicas
2da Ronda – Entrevista Técnica
El Entrevistador me hizo 3 Preguntas en esta ronda y duró 30-40 minutos.
- Encuentre el máximo del mínimo para cada tamaño de ventana k en una array dada.
- Diseñe una estructura de datos que admita las funciones AddElement(), DeleteElement() y getRandomElement() en una complejidad de tiempo O(1).
- Problema de distribución de dulces
6 estudiantes fueron preseleccionados después de esta ronda para la próxima ronda.
3ra Ronda – Entrevista Técnica
El Entrevistador me hizo 3 Preguntas en esta ronda y duró 30-40 minutos.
- Supongamos que nos dan n elementos y m pares (a,b) donde cada par denota que la altura del elefante a es menor que la altura del elefante b . Necesitamos determinar uno de los órdenes posibles de la altura de los elefantes y generarlo en la forma (por ejemplo) a < b < c.
Aquí escribí uno de los órdenes posibles porque si el número de pares dados es menor que el número de pares requerido para determinar el orden real, entonces necesitamos imprimir todos los órdenes posibles de alturas de elefantes. - Encuentre el máximo valor robado posible de las casas
- 0-1 Problema de la mochila
Me hicieron esta pregunta tergiversando el lenguaje tomando el ejemplo de IPL donde cada jugador tiene una calificación y un costo. Necesitamos maximizar la calificación dado el presupuesto fijo.
Luego me preguntaron, ya que para el enfoque básico de DP necesitamos hacer una array 2-D en la que el número de columnas sea igual al presupuesto que tenemos. Entonces, este enfoque básico de DP ocupa mucho espacio innecesario. Imagine el caso en el que el presupuesto = 500, entonces necesitamos hacer 500 columnas en nuestra array. Entonces pidieron un mejor enfoque. Les di mi enfoque en ese momento. No sé si era correcto o no porque el entrevistador solo escuchó mi enfoque y no dijo nada y terminó la entrevista.
Después de esta ronda, seleccionaron a 3 estudiantes de mi universidad. yo era uno de ellos
Este artículo es una contribución de Shubham Jindal . Si le gusta GeeksforGeeks y le gustaría contribuir, también puede escribir un artículo usando contribuya.geeksforgeeks.org o envíe su artículo por correo a contribuya@geeksforgeeks.org. Vea su artículo que aparece en la página principal de GeeksforGeeks y ayude a otros Geeks.
Escriba comentarios si encuentra algo incorrecto o si desea compartir más información sobre el tema tratado anteriormente.
Publicación traducida automáticamente
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A